HTML Links - HTML Internal Link « Previous Next » HTML internal link is linked within the same web page. This link can be an absolute path or relative path. HTML internal link name is followed by the hash sign (#). You have to assign an id to refer section of your page, which is referred to as an internal link to the same page.

The innerHTML property can be used to examine the current HTML source of the page, including any changes that have been made since the page was initially loaded. Reading the HTML contents of an element Reading innerHTML causes the user agent to serialize the HTML or XML fragment comprised of the element's descendants.

Section Names. Basically, page jumps are just links (they use the same element as all links), but links that point to a certain part of a document. This is done by assigning names to parts of your page, and then making the link by referring to that section.. Page jumps are done by using the name attribute of the a element. The nested link gets kicked out. My first inclination would be to simply not nest the links in the markup, but make them appear nested visually. Some folks replied to the tweet, including Nathan Smith, who shared that same thought: have a relatively positioned parent element and absolutely position both links.

Part 1 Creating a Destination Anchor Download Article 1 Create an anchor element. The "anchor" element defines a place on the page that you can link to. Anything inside the and tags, typically text or an image, can be the destination of the link. 2 Place something inside the anchor element.

It has the following syntax: link text The most important attribute of the element is the href attribute, which indicates the link's destination. The link text is the part that will be visible to the reader. Clicking on the link text, will send the reader to the specified URL address. Example
